Микропроцессорные средства и системы 1987 №3 1986 г.

Справочная информация - краткое сообщение.


КРАТКОЕ
СООБЩЕНИЕ

УДК 681.3.06

В. П. Гонтаренко, Ю. А. Пупин

система

подготовки

программ
микропроцессора
кр580ик80 на базе
микроэвм
«электроника дз-28»

Разработана кросс-система на
ассемблере широко распространенной
микроЭВМ «Электроника ДЗ-28»,
предназначенная для отладки прог-
рамм, написанных в мнемокодах мик-
ропроцессора КР580ИК80.

С помощью данной кросс-си-
стемы пользователь может вводить
текст отлаживаемой программы,
просматривать его на дисплее и ре-
дактировать, получать транслирован-
ную программу, моделировать ее вы-
полнение, записывать и загружать с
магнитной ленты текст программы.
При вводе текста программы с кла-
виатуры контролируется синтаксис
мнемоники команд, а при трансля-
ции — операнды с выдачей пользова-
телю списка обнаруженных ошибок.
При моделировании программ, кото-
рое может выполняться как пошаго-
во, так и автоматически (с возмож-
ностью задания адреса останова), для
контроля правильности их функциони-
рования система при остановах вы-
дает на дисплей содержимое регист-
ров микропроцессора. Преобразование
данных в ОЗУ системы можно конт-
ролировать в режиме прямого досту-
па к памяти. Отлаженные программы
документируются: пользователь полу-
чает листинг траслированной програм-
мы с указанием мнемоники каждой
команды, ее абсолютного адреса и
двоичных кодов. Объем ОЗУ модели-
руемой системы составляет 10К байт;
объем памяти, занимаемой кросс-сис-
темой,—11,5К байт. Подключив к
микроЭВМ «Электроника ДЗ-28»
программатор РПЗУ, можно записать
в него транслированную программу. В
кросс-систему при этом должна быть
включена подпрограмма для обслу-
живания программатора.

Моделирующая программа реали-
зована в машинных кодах микроЭВМ
«Электроника ДЗ-28»; этим дости-
гается высокое быстродействие вы-
полнения программ микропроцессора.

Кросс-система принята в отрасле-
вой фонд алгоритмов и программ
(НИ ВЦ МГУ) с инвентарным JNfe
50860000771 от 17.07.86.

Рис. llt Схема подключения микро-
схем серии КР556 при электротермо-

тренировке:
Ucc — источник постоянного напряжения;
G — многоканальный генератор прямо-
угольных импульсов; параметры импульса:
амплитуда 2,4...4,5 В; скважность 2; дли-
тельность фронта < 100 не.
Импульсы с генератора G подаются на ад-
ресные входы микросхемы, начиная с АО
до Am в следующей последовательности:
Ь=50Гц...1МГц. fi-fo/2, fm = f0/2m,
где m — старший разряд адреса микро-
схемы. На выводы CS подается частота
f-fo^m + i; Rl1 = 300 Om±5%; Rl2=620
Ом±5 %

Микросхемы, у которых в процес-
се ЭТТ произошла потеря записан-
ной информации, можно программи-
ровать повторно. После повторной
записи информации микросхемы
вновь подвергают ЭТТ, после чего
вновь контролируется запись инфор-
мации При повторном незапрограм-
мировании микросхемы должны
быть забракованы*

Подготовила Воробьева Я. Я,
тел. 536-57-55, Москва.

Статья поступила 18 марта 1987 г.




СОДЕРЖАНИЕ:


  Оставте Ваш отзыв:

  НИК/ИМЯ
  ПОЧТА (шифруется)
  КОД



Темы: Игры, Программное обеспечение, Пресса, Аппаратное обеспечение, Сеть, Демосцена, Люди, Программирование

Похожие статьи:
Железо - Описание блока памяти от принтера Robotron CM 6329.01 M. Часть 1.
Сначала - Закинутая в долгий ящик "читалка" была наконец извлечена на свет, с нее сдули пыль, причесали,подровняли и результат налицо.
Планета Шелезяка - Музыкальная карта General Sound.
Разбиралка - Как пройти за 10 минут Войны Эмбера.
Пресс-релиз - интервью Quasar'a "Спектрум окончательно выдохся, выродившись в нечто аморфное, само существование и имя которого поддерживается лишь виртуально".

В этот день...   1 января

SibNews #08, Woot! #01, Spectrum Magazine #01, ACNews #25, Psychoz #14, ACNews #14, Last 128 #08, Last 128 #06, Last 128 #05, Last 128 #04, Last 128 #03, Last 128 #02, Last 128 #09, Last 128 #3.5, Last 128 #8.025, Sinclair Club #05, Last 128 #M!R 01, Fantadrom #01, Buzz #20, Last 128 #01, DonNews #13, Nicron #120, Promised Land #01, Inferno #01, Marazm #25, Ultimathum #01, Marazm #21, Hooy Mag #02, KrNews #11, Marazm #22, Marazm #23, ZX Football 2000 #01, Codemania #01, Always #03, Bugs #02, IzhNews #08, Virtual Worlds #01, Listok #04, Scenergy #02, Flash Info #18, Marazm #16, Marazm #17, Zed #01, Balagan #02, ZX Format #08, ZX Power #03, Shock #01, Impulse #02, Deja Vu #03, ZX Club #08, ZX Club #06, Numberology #01, Marazm #13, Marazm #12, Marazm #14, Gorodok #02, Zodiac #01, Marazm #15, Deja Vu #07, Marazm #11, Deja Vu #07, Playboy #03, Crazy News #2, Crazy News #4, ZX Light #01, Crazy News #5, Playboy #02, ZX News #03, ZX Review #1-2, Read Me #02, Crazy News #3, Nicron #13, Read Me #01, Public Spirit #01, Faultless #06, Faultless #05, ZX Software #01, Stump #04, Speccy #07, Возраждение #0, Speccy #03, On-Line #17, Scene+ #01, Welcome Press #01, ZX Konig #04, Adventurer #01, Faultless #05, Faultless #04, Di Halt #01, Faultless #01, Playboy #01, Crazy News #1, Faultless #03, Pioneer #03, Sinclair Town #02, ZX Magazine #01, Eldorado #01, ZX Magazine #02, Spectron #01, ZX News #01, ZX Konig #02, 200 #W, Welcome Press #00, Dune #07, Subliminal Extacy #01, Subliminal Extacy #02, ZX Konig #01, Subliminal Extacy #00, Muchomor #01, Spectrofon #01, ZX Revija #02, Outlet #01, Outlet #1-3